Types of Audi Car Keys


Audi employs a number of types of keys, depending on the model and year. Comprehending these keys is important for new and existing Audi owners alike.

1. Standard Key

Earlier models of Audi vehicles featured a conventional mechanical key. This basic metallic key allowed chauffeurs to unlock and begin their cars and trucks. These keys are now largely phased out in favor of more sophisticated systems.

2. Key Fob

Most modern Audi models feature key fobs, which offer both convenience and security. Key fobs can control various functions, consisting of locking and unlocking doors and trunk access, and often consist of a panic button.

3. Smart Key

Smart keys, likewise referred to as distance keys, represent the peak of key technology. With a clever key system, chauffeurs can unlock the car door and begin the engine without eliminating the key fob from their pocket or bag.

4. Mobile App Integration

Lots of contemporary Audi automobiles come geared up with smart device integration, permitting owners to use an app to access their cars. This innovation provides a new era of connection, allowing functions such as remote locking and opening, area tracking, and engine start/stop capabilities.

Key Technology


Understanding the innovation behind Audi car keys can help owners appreciate the level of security and benefit these keys offer.

A. Transponder Technology

The majority of Audi keys are geared up with transponder chips. When the key is placed into the ignition or brought within proximity of the automobile, the transponder interacts with the car's onboard computer to validate the key. This avoids theft and unapproved gain access to.

B. Keyless Entry Systems

Keyless entry systems make use of radio frequency recognition (RFID) technology. When the key fob is within a certain range of the vehicle, it can open the doors automatically. This is particularly helpful for motorists bring groceries or other items, as they can simply approach their car, and it will open without them requiring to push a button.

C. Remote Start Feature

Lots of new Audi models include remote start capabilities. This function enables motorists to begin their engine from a distance, an excellent benefit for those living in cooler climates, where heating up the car before going into is a common practice.

D. Security Features

Audi incorporates numerous security functions into its key technology, consisting of rolling code systems that generate a new code each time the key is utilized. In case of a key theft, these systems make it challenging for the thief to get to the automobile.

Typical Issues and Solutions


A. Lost or Stolen Keys

If an Audi key is lost or taken, it is crucial to act without delay. Audi automobiles can be reprogrammed to disable the lost key, preventing unauthorized access. It is recommended to call an authorized Audi dealer for assistance in such cases.

B. Battery Replacement

Key fobs and wise keys require batteries, which might need replacement with time. Audi owners ought to consult their user manual for guidance on how to replace the battery, usually a basic process that can be done in your home.

C. Programming New Keys

If extra keys are needed, or if a replacement is needed, it frequently includes programming the new key to deal with the car's systems. This process ought to be carried out by a licensed dealer or a certified automobile locksmith professional familiar with Audi key systems.

FAQs About Audi Car Keys


Q1: How do I know which type of key my Audi uses?

A: Check your vehicle's manual, or call your regional Audi dealership for assistance in determining the key type based on your design and year.

Q2: Can I change my lost Audi key myself?

A: While you can buy aftermarket keys, replacement and programming generally require specialized equipment that many car owners do not possess. It's advised to look for assistance from a licensed Audi dealership.

Q3: How can I increase the life-span of my Audi key?

A: Regularly examine the battery status, keep the key clean and dry, and prevent exposing it to extreme temperature levels.

Q4: What should I do if my key fob stops working?

A: First, check and replace the battery if necessary. If the key fob is still unresponsive, it may require reprogramming or replacement, which can be handled by a dealer.
